    for the love of God, muscle does NOT weigh more than fat. it takes up less space is all.

    That's what "weighs more than" means in the comparative sense. Obviously one pound of muscle is going to weigh the same as one pound of fat. But given certain size parameters, 1 cu ft of muscle is heavier than 1 cu ft of fat.

    Just like a pile of feathers weighs less than a pile of bowling balls, if the piles are of equal size.
